Product Overview

Category

The MB91F016APFV-GS-9024K5E1 belongs to the category of microcontrollers.

Use

This microcontroller is commonly used in various electronic devices and systems for controlling and processing data.

Characteristics

  • High-performance microcontroller with advanced features
  • Low power consumption
  • Compact size
  • Wide operating temperature range
  • Robust design for reliable operation

Package

The MB91F016APFV-GS-9024K5E1 is available in a compact package, suitable for surface mount technology (SMT) assembly.

Essence

The essence of this microcontroller lies in its ability to efficiently control and process data, enabling the smooth operation of electronic devices and systems.

Packaging/Quantity

The MB91F016APFV-GS-9024K5E1 is typically packaged in reels or trays, with a quantity of 1000 units per package.

Specifications

  • Microcontroller model: MB91F016APFV-GS-9024K5E1
  • Architecture: 16-bit RISC
  • Clock frequency: Up to 50 MHz
  • Flash memory: 128 KB
  • RAM: 8 KB
  • Operating voltage: 2.7V - 5.5V
  • I/O pins: 24
  • Communication interfaces: UART, SPI, I2C
  • Analog-to-digital converter (ADC): 10-bit resolution, 8 channels
  • Timers: Multiple timers with various modes
  • Operating temperature range: -40°C to +85°C

Working Principles

The MB91F016APFV-GS-9024K5E1 microcontroller operates based on the principles of digital logic and data processing. It executes instructions stored in its flash memory, manipulating data and controlling external devices through its I/O pins. The clock frequency determines the speed at which instructions are processed, while the various peripherals and interfaces enable communication and interaction with the external world.
